Amazing Spiderman

Being a comic book geek I really want to love this film, but on a second viewing I didn't have the blinkers on, it's good, but it's just not great, there's brilliant parts, the casting is perfect, but the plot just doesn't get going for me, the Lizard was an awful choice as a central threat and poorly visualized.

Really hope they take a lead from Sam Raimi's second film and bring him out into the daylight, and really visualize his web slinging, that's what Raimi's really nailed in the second.

Saying that this is the first, and should be taken as such, just a little more difficult to watch an origin story so close to the previous iteration.

7/10
